Intro to Sales

EQ - How do I develop an effective sales pitch?
  1. Activator - Sell This Pen
    1. Create a Flipgrid to sell your pen
    2. What went well? 
    3. What could be improved?
  2. Sales Process
    1. Intro to Selling - Read For Understanding
    2. Customer First Approach - LINK Article
  3. Sales Pitch Questionnaire - Shark Tank
    1. Was this an effective sales pitch?  Why or why not?  (provide at least 3 points of support)
    2. Identify what the Sharks were looking for to say yes.
    3. Was a relationship developed between the sales person and the prospective customers?  Explain.
  4. Compare and Contrast the your sales pitch to the lessons presented
    1. What patterns can be identified that are beneficial to a sales pitch?
    2. What errors were made in your initial pitch?
    3. Describe how you would change you initial sales pitch.
  5. Sell This Pen Part 2 - FlipGrid
  6. Evaluation Process
    1. Measure the amount of time each person spoke. 
      1. Was it more of a monologue than a dialogue?
      2. How close to the 80/20 recommendation were you?
    2. Identify the step taken to qualify the buyer.
    3. Identify the step/words that identified the motive.
    4. Identify how the seller acknowledged the communication of the buyer AND if/how the seller connected to the buyer with authenticity.
    5. Did the seller mention anything that communicated scarcity?
  7. Franchise Development Groups
    1. Use what you have learned to create a sales presentation to sell your franchise to a billionaire.  
    2. Presentations will occur Tuesday during class.
